What's Happening?
Artificial intelligence is becoming a cornerstone in the biopharma manufacturing sector, with companies leveraging machine learning tools to enhance output and efficiency. The industry is in the early stages of a digital transformation, with AI being applied to various tasks across the drug production process. Companies like Biogen and Sanofi are aiming for end-to-end integrated process control and fully automated operations. Sanofi is also focusing on using AI to optimize production lines and improve quality, while Moderna is exploring real-time monitoring and decision support systems. The integration of AI with robotics is also being explored to reduce costs and variability in production processes.
Why It's Important?
The adoption of AI in drug manufacturing holds significant implications for the industry, potentially leading to increased efficiency, reduced costs, and improved product quality. By automating processes and enhancing supply chain management, companies can better respond to market demands and disruptions. This technological shift could also contribute to sustainability goals by optimizing resource use. However, the integration of AI also presents risks, such as system failures and cybersecurity threats, which companies must manage carefully. The move towards AI-driven operations reflects a broader trend in the industry towards digital transformation and innovation.
